求大神秒杀,mfc中的CString.Format,用%s处理数组之后,为什么会有多余的东西在字符串后?
char*pszFileName="G:\\myfile.txt";CStdioFiledestFile(pszFileName,CFile::modeCreate|CF...
char* pszFileName="G:\\myfile.txt";
CStdioFile destFile(pszFileName, CFile::modeCreate | CFile::modeWrite | CFile::modeNoTruncate);
byte data[5];
for(byte j=0;j<5;j++) { data[j] = j+0x30; }
CString string0("");
string0.Format("%s",data);
destFile.WriteString(string0+"\n");
destFile.Close();
请大神指教! 展开
CStdioFile destFile(pszFileName, CFile::modeCreate | CFile::modeWrite | CFile::modeNoTruncate);
byte data[5];
for(byte j=0;j<5;j++) { data[j] = j+0x30; }
CString string0("");
string0.Format("%s",data);
destFile.WriteString(string0+"\n");
destFile.Close();
请大神指教! 展开
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询